What is a CS2 Casino?

A CS2 gambling establishment is a third-party online gambling platform that uses digital products from Valve's tactical shooter, Counter-Strike 2, as currency. Rather than using conventional fiat currency (like GBP or EUR) solely, these platforms generally permit users to deposit, wager, and withdraw virtual weapon skins, knives, and gloves.

Gradually, much of these platforms have actually developed to accept cryptocurrencies (Bitcoin, Ethereum, GBPT) and traditional payment techniques, transforming genuine money into site-specific credits. Nevertheless, the core identity of a CS2 gambling establishment remains deeply tied to the video game's special virtual economy.

How the Ecosystem Works

  1. Acquisition: Players obtain CS2 skins through in-game drops, opening official Valve cases, or acquiring them on the Steam Community Market and third-party marketplaces.
  2. Deposit: Players log into a CS2 casino utilizing their Steam accounts and trade their virtual skins to a bot controlled by the platform in exchange for site balance.
  3. Wagering: Users play different gambling establishment games using their balance or skins.
  4. Withdrawal: If gamers win, they can use their balance to acquire different (and often better) skins from the platform's inventory, which are then traded back to their Steam accounts.

Risks and Challenges Associated with CS2 Gambling

While the excitement is palpable, taking part in CS2 gambling establishment games comes with considerable dangers that every user need to understand.

1. Regulative Uncertainty

The majority of CS2 casinos run without main licenses from recognized gambling authorities (such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ority). Since they use virtual products instead of direct fiat currency in numerous instances, they often run in legal gray locations across different jurisdictions.

2. Lack of Consumer Protection

Due to the fact that these platforms are uncontrolled by traditional standards, users have little to no option if a site declines to pay jackpots, modifies its terms of service suddenly, or shuts down totally.

3. Valve's Stance and Trade Bans

Valve Corporation has actually traditionally punished third-party gambling sites. The developer has regularly upgraded its policies, executing trade hold timers (e.g., a 7-day constraint on traded products) and issuing sweeping bans to automated bot accounts related to gambling platforms. This introduces a high level of counterparty threat for users holding balances on these sites.

4. Financial and Addiction Risks

The gamification of gambling-- especially when covered in the colorful aesthetic appeals of a beloved video game-- can make it challenging for younger audiences to recognize the threats of problem gambling. Chasing after losses can rapidly cause considerable monetary damage.
